In this episode, we share the unlikely story of how a dating app brought us together, and how, just two weeks from now, we’ll be married! From our personal histories with dating to the stigma that still surrounds meeting a romantic partner online, we dive into the reasons why apps have become a powerful (and sometimes necessary) way to connect. Along the way, we also explore the challenges of meeting people in person, the enduring fantasy and desire of doing so, and even offer some practical tips—like how to catch someone’s attention at the gym. Dating apps aren’t bad. Are they ideal? Maybe not. What they are is as a useful means to the END for which we’re all yearning: a meaningful, lasting, loving relationship.Maybe you’d like more personalized help to improve your health?
